By Jonathan Snook, Stuart Langridge, Aaron Gustafson, Dan Webb
<h3>What you’ll learn</h3> * the place CSS, HTML, and the DOM healthy into smooth scripting, and the way to take advantage of them jointly successfully
* the way to construct potent shape validation into your purposes utilizing Ajax
* find out how to create mashups utilizing APIs
* the right way to construct dynamic person interfaces
<h3>Who this ebook is for</h3>
* Object-Oriented Programming
* Ajax and knowledge alternate
* visible results
* Case examine: FAQ Facelift
* A Dynamic aid procedure
Read Online or Download Accelerated DOM Scripting with Ajax, APIs, and Libraries PDF
Best web development books
It's not only one other ebook on Ajax. It's Pragmatic Ajax: a concise, whole examine a brand new manner of envisioning and enforcing browser-based functions.
Ajax turns static web content into interactive functions. you can now set up rich-client functions to consumers with no sacrificing the simple deployment of internet purposes. yet to many people, Ajax turns out tricky. That's why we produced this publication. As a practical advisor, it strips away the secret and exhibits you the straightforward option to make Ajax be just right for you.
With Pragmatic Ajax, you'll: * comprehend the breadth of the Ajax/Web 2. zero panorama, and go-indepth on how Ajax works
* See the right way to simply practice Ajax innovations to an current application--and whilst to not
* be aware of what's coming by means of taking a look at new good points and frameworks at the moment in lively development.
Writing dynamic purposes isn't that tough. parents are awed by means of Google Maps, however it isn't rocket technological know-how (apart from the satellite tv for pc pictures). As a unique bonus, see the best way to enforce your personal Google Maps-like program utilizing DHTML.
JQuery 2. zero is the most recent model of the jQuery framework. appropriate for contemporary internet browsers it presents a powerful API for net software improvement. it truly is speedy turning into the instrument of selection for net builders internationally and units the traditional for simplicity,flexibility and extensibility in web design.
Weird browser insects, inconsistent CSS/JS help, functionality concerns, cellular fragmentation, machine pixels, viewports, zooming, contact occasion cascade, pointer and click on occasions and the 300-millisecond hold up. No, cellular isn’t darkish subject, however it does require you to profit a number of new issues, a few of that are particularly confusing.
The cellular internet instruction manual can assist you to make experience of all of it. It’s our fresh useful consultant for facing front-end demanding situations on cellular — successfully. Written via Peter-Paul Koch, it positive aspects contemporary examine findings and indicates the intricacies of cellular, with its universal difficulties and workarounds, and can provide what it supplies: real-world recommendation for cellular — very particular and intensely useful.
How do you deal with cellular browsers? What do you want to grasp approximately networks, operators and equipment owners? What's the tale at the back of place: fastened, overflow: automobile and the 3 viewports? Are contact occasions trustworthy and the way precisely do they paintings? and the way do you try out on cellular besides? The publication covers these types of matters intimately, with plenty of sensible takeaways alongside the way.
In truth, construction web content for cellular is buggy, until you recognize why those insects arise. With The cellular instruction manual, you'll research simply that — and likewise how you can take on universal concerns prior to time, even sooner than they arrive up. The booklet may be worthy for cellular strategists, builders, designers, and everyone keen to raised comprehend the intricacies of cellular — either technical and market-related. even if you need to get a greater photograph or dive deep into universal browser insects on cellular, this is often simply the ebook you need.
Table of Contents
bankruptcy 1: The cellular global
bankruptcy 2: Browsers
bankruptcy three: Android
bankruptcy four: Viewports
bankruptcy five: CSS
bankruptcy 6: contact and Pointer occasions
bankruptcy 7: changing into a cellular net developer
bankruptcy eight: the way forward for the internet on Mobile
About the Author
Peter-Paul Koch (PPK) has been round the internet for a while. identified for his browser compatibility tables on Quirksmode. org, he's a cellular platform strategist, browser researcher, advisor, and coach in Amsterdam, the Netherlands. He makes a speciality of the cellular net, and particularly cellular browser learn, advising cellular and computer browser owners on their implementation of internet criteria.
WordPress could be a daunting beast for running a blog novices. fortunately, this publication is right here to assist! the recent version of WordPress for rookies will train you every thing you want to comprehend with thought and guide for bloggers simply getting began. You’ll find out about deciding upon topics, simple CSS, importing media and lots more and plenty extra.
- Real-World Flash Game Development: How to Follow Best Practices AND Keep Your Sanity (2nd Edition)
- Das XHTML, HTML und CCS.
- Beginning jQuery 2 for ASP.NET Developers: Using jQuery 2 with ASP.NET Web Forms and ASP.NET MVC
- HTML, XHTML, and CSS: Comprehensive (6th Edition)
Additional resources for Accelerated DOM Scripting with Ajax, APIs, and Libraries
If you had used three class selectors (level C) in a ruleset, and a second ruleset had two class selectors (also level C), the first ruleset would have higher specificity than the second. • More importantly, a selector at a higher level has higher specificity than a number at a lower level. If you had a ruleset with an id selector (level B) and a second ruleset with three class selectors (level C) and an element selector (level D), the first ruleset would have higher specificity than the second.
The DOM tree diagram, with the attribute and text nodes added As you can see, that tree structure just got a few more branches. Keep in mind—and this is important—that even the space between tags is represented by a text node. IE, in its usual desire to be different, doesn’t recognize that blank space as a node. When you get to traversing the DOM, you’ll need to keep this browser difference in mind (discussed later in this chapter). The document Object Now that you know what the DOM is, let’s have a look at how you use it (using the document object, of course).